Core Skills Analysis
English
- The student improved their vocabulary by interacting with other players in the game. Communication was essential in forming strategies and working as a team.
- Reading and interpreting game instructions and dialogues in the game helped the student enhance their reading comprehension skills.
- The storytelling aspect of the game encouraged the student to think critically about plot development and character motivations.
- Writing messages or notes to team members during the game promoted the student's written communication skills and concise messaging.
Tips
To further enhance language skills through gaming, consider discussing themes, character development, and narratives in games like Fortnight. Encourage writing short stories or character backgrounds inspired by gaming experiences. Utilize in-game text for reading practice and comprehension exercises. Engage in multiplayer games that require strategic planning and teamwork to foster effective communication skills.
Book Recommendations
- Ready Player One by Ernest Cline: A science fiction novel set in a dystopian future where virtual reality gaming is prevalent, exploring themes of gaming, technology, and adventure.
- Ender's Game by Orson Scott Card: Follows a young boy who excels in a series of virtual reality war games, showcasing strategic thinking, leadership, and interpersonal skills in a gaming context.
- The Ultimate Player's Guide to Minecraft by Stephen O'Brien: While not about Fortnight specifically, this guide offers insights into gaming strategies, creativity, and problem-solving skills, valuable for gaming enthusiasts.
